Output 120328bba0f7771b847c2ef75a5f3655dbc13d7bca87c589d9c6f155c385d081:1

value
46546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1ae735b2b2c860c649170f200008fda9d36eff7 OP_EQUALVERIFY OP_CHECKSIG
address
1MaJ2Ckw38Vjmvn6EXaDjuywtEKQEdSf2c
transaction
120328bba0f7771b847c2ef75a5f3655dbc13d7bca87c589d9c6f155c385d081
spent
true